DO YOU KNOW VIANA DO CASTELO? Viana do Castelo is one of the most beautiful cities in northern Portugal. Its participation in the Portuguese Discoveries and later in cod fishing shows its traditional connection to the sea. Viana do Castelo is easily accessible from Porto or Valença for those coming from Spain. From the Santa Luzia hill, you can observe the city's privileged geographical location, next to the sea and the mouth of the Lima River. This stunning view and the Temple of the Sacred Heart of Jesus, a revivalist building by Ventura Terra, from 1898, can be the starting point for visiting the city.
Facing the sea that made Viana's history, a Baroque church guards the image of Senhora da Agonia, a devotion of the fishermen. Every year, on August 20th, it sets sail to bless the sea in one of Portugal's most colorful festivals, where the beauty and richness of traditional costumes are on display. Viana is also known for its gold filigree and has managed to maintain its traditions, as can be seen in the Costume Museum (costume and gold), the Municipal Museum (with a special focus on Viana's typical pottery), or the Gil Eanes ship. Built in Viana do Castelo's shipyards to support cod fishing, the ship is now anchored here as a memory of the city's maritime and shipbuilding traditions. In the city's surroundings, you can take a walk along the coastal or river bike path or one of the many marked trails, as well as practice surfing, windsurfing, or kitesurfing and bodyboarding on fine, golden sand beaches.
